| From: o1bigtenor via talk <[email protected]> | Reading past emails it seems that using a separate provider for domain | registration and web hosting is the suggested norm.
Just to make things more difficult, there are three separate things. 1. domain registration 2. domain hosting (by which I mean hosting your domain's DNS zone file). 3. hosting any services, such as web pages So 2 is what you missed. Often the registration service provider will host your DNS. But if you get into a dispute with them, you may have problems. That's not from experience and it might be a non-issue. --- Post to this mailing list [email protected] Unsubscribe from this mailing list https://gtalug.org/mailman/listinfo/talk
